Tutoriais

▷ O que é ssd, como funciona e para que serve?

Índice:

Anonim

Discos rígidos, ou melhor, unidades de armazenamento de estado sólido ou SSDs estão aqui para ficar. Quase todos os usuários que compram novos equipamentos podem encontrar uma unidade de armazenamento desse tipo dentro. Mas o que é realmente um SSD e como ele funciona ? Neste artigo, falaremos detalhadamente sobre esse elemento eletrônico e o que o diferencia dos conhecidos discos rígidos HDD.

Índice de conteúdo

Desde alguns anos, tivemos a sorte de experimentar grandes mudanças em nossos computadores. Primeiro foram os processadores com vários núcleos e sua arquitetura. Isso fez com que o equipamento se tornasse cada vez mais rápido, placas gráficas aprimoradas, RAM. Mas ainda havia um grande gargalo em nossa equipe e não era outro senão o disco rígido. Com o computador inteiro cheio de circuitos integrados, ainda tínhamos um elemento mecânico dentro.

Portanto, seria inútil ter um processador extremamente rápido se o acesso ao conteúdo dos dados fosse realmente lento. Por esse e outros motivos, o setor de armazenamento digital começou a trabalhar e, consequentemente, reduziu os custos de criação desse novo tipo de unidades. Como seu custo diminuiu, o mesmo ocorreu com a capacidade de armazenar dados e também com sua confiabilidade.

Atualmente, já temos esse elemento praticamente padronizado e comum em todos os novos equipamentos. E a um preço relativamente acessível. Se você deseja um computador rápido, deve ter um destes para o seu sistema operacional. Então, vamos ver o que são essas unidades SSD.

O que é um SSD

A unidade de estado sólido ou SSD (unidade de estado sólido) é um dispositivo de armazenamento de dados com base no uso de memória não volátil ou comumente chamada de memória flash. Substituindo assim os discos magnéticos dos discos rígidos tradicionais.

Essas memórias flash, sucessoras da antiga EEPROM, permitem operações de leitura e gravação de vários locais de memória na mesma operação, aumentando assim a velocidade em comparação com as memórias da EEPROM, que só podiam ler uma célula de memória em cada operação.

O uso da memória flash envolve o uso de chips para armazenar memória. Ao eliminar as partes móveis de um disco rígido normal, aumentaremos consideravelmente seu acesso e velocidade de gravação.

Em 2010, esses relatórios deram outro salto, o que realmente levou à redução dos custos de fabricação e, portanto, à acessibilidade deles pelos usuários. E é o uso de portas NAND para fabricar essas memórias flash.

Um dos recursos mais impressionantes de um portão lógico NAND (AND ou Y invertido) é que ele pode reter dados internos, mesmo quando a energia foi cortada.

Essas portas NAND são feitas usando transistores de porta flutuante, que é um item em que os bits são armazenados. No caso de memórias RAM, esses transistores precisam de uma fonte de alimentação contínua para manter seu estado, e não nas memórias flash. Quando um transistor de porta flutuante é carregado, ele possui um 0 e, quando é descarregado, possui um 1.

Essas memórias são organizadas em forma de matriz, que por sua vez é formada por uma série de portas NAND consecutivas. Chamamos o bloco matriz completo e as linhas que compõem a matriz são chamadas páginas. Cada uma dessas linhas tem uma capacidade de armazenamento entre 2 KB e 16 KB. Se cada bloco tiver 256 páginas, teremos um tamanho entre 256 KB e 4 MB.

Diferença entre SSD e RAM

Com isso, a primeira coisa que vem à mente é a memória RAM. Como sabemos, esse tipo de memória é usado para fornecer dados e programas ao processador. Quando desligamos um computador, a memória RAM está completamente vazia, ao contrário das unidades SSD.

A diferença está no uso de portões NAND. Esses elementos lógicos armazenam o último estado elétrico interno e também permanecem sem fonte de alimentação.

Tecnologias de Manufatura

Basicamente, existem duas tecnologias de armazenamento para a fabricação desses dispositivos. Começou experimentando unidades baseadas em RAM. Isso exigia um elemento que constantemente os fornecia energia para não perder os dados.

Devido a essas limitações, a tecnologia DRAM nessas unidades foi descartada com o aparecimento de portas NAND com armazenamento não volátil. Essa é a usada atualmente e existem três tecnologias de fabricação diferentes:

SLC ou célula de nível individual

Usando esse método, é possível armazenar um bit de dados para cada célula da memória. Sua construção é feita de pastilhas de silício individuais com as quais você obtém um chip de memória fino e um único nível de armazenamento. Esses chips têm as vantagens de uma maior velocidade de acesso a dados, maior longevidade e menor consumo de energia. Por outro lado, possuem menor capacidade de memória, sendo necessário construir um maior número de porcas, aumentando o custo de construção.

Por enquanto, sua fabricação é limitada a ambientes industriais e de cluster de servidores, nos quais a qualidade do armazenamento deve ser superior.

MLC ou célula multinível

Este método de fabricação é exatamente o oposto do anterior. Cada chip de memória é fabricado empilhando pastilhas de silício para formar um único chip de vários níveis. Como suas vantagens são as de maior capacidade de armazenamento por chip, é possível armazenar dois bits para cada célula, o que perfaz um total de 4 estados diferentes. E também um custo de fabricação mais barato.

Como desvantagens, citamos exatamente o oposto do que no caso anterior: acesso mais lento e chips com menos durabilidade.

TLC ou célula de nível triplo

Nesse caso, o processo de fabricação consegue implementar 3 bits para cada célula, permitindo que até 8 estados sejam armazenados. O preço de fabricação é mais barato e o acesso ao conteúdo é menos eficiente. São, portanto, as unidades mais baratas de adquirir, mas com uma vida útil da célula limitada a cerca de 1000 gravações.

Tecnologia TRIM

Um assunto pendente nas unidades de armazenamento SSD é precisamente a sua durabilidade. As células de memória são degradadas a cada gravação e exclusão executadas nelas, o que faz com que as unidades muito usadas sejam degradadas rapidamente, causando falhas na integridade do arquivo e perda de arquivos.

O processo de exclusão de arquivos de um SSD é bastante complexo. Podemos escrever conteúdo no nível da linha, mas podemos excluir apenas no nível do bloco. Isso implica que, se houver arquivos úteis nesse bloco, além daqueles que devem ser excluídos, isso também será excluído.

Para impedir que arquivos válidos sejam excluídos, esses arquivos devem ser obtidos e salvos em uma nova linha, exclua o bloco e reescreva os dados válidos onde estavam anteriormente. A conseqüência de todo esse processo é uma degradação adicional das células da memória, tendo que fazer gravações e exclusões extras.

Em resposta a isso, emergem tecnologias como o TRIM. O TRIM permite a comunicação entre o sistema operacional e a unidade de armazenamento, para que seja o próprio sistema que informa ao SSD os dados que devem ser apagados. Quando apagamos dados no Windows, eles não são apagados fisicamente, mas adquirem a propriedade de não serem usados. Isso permite diminuir os processos de escrita e apagamento físico das células da memória. Da Microsoft, essa tecnologia foi implementada desde o Windows 7.

Componentes físicos de uma unidade SSD

Em relação aos componentes de uma unidade SSD, podemos mencionar três elementos críticos:

Controlador: é o processador encarregado de administrar e gerenciar as operações realizadas nos módulos de memória NAND.

Cache: também neste tipo de unidades, existe um dispositivo de memória DRAM para acelerar o processo de transmissão de dados da unidade para a RAM e o processador.

Capacitor: Os capacitores têm a função de manter a integridade dos dados quando houver interrupções repentinas de energia. Se houver dados em movimento devido a um corte, graças aos capacitores, será possível armazenar esses dados para evitar perdas.

Tecnologias de conexão

SATA

Os SSDs comuns têm a mesma tecnologia de conexão que os discos rígidos normais, ou seja, eles usam uma porta SATA 3 para conectá-los à placa-mãe. Dessa forma, teremos uma transferência de 600 MB / s.

PCI-Express

Mas há outra tecnologia de conexão e comunicação ainda mais rápida, chamada NVMe. Usando esse método, as unidades serão conectadas diretamente aos slots de expansão PCI-Express em nossa placa-mãe. Dessa maneira, é possível obter velocidades de transferência de até 2 GB / s na leitura e 1, 5 GB / s na escrita.

Como é normal, esses discos rígidos não possuem o formato típico de encapsulamento retangular de 2, 5 polegadas, mas parecem placas de expansão, como capturadores ou placas gráficas sem dissipador de calor.

M.2

Este é o novo padrão de comunicação destinado a substituir o tipo SATA a médio e curto prazo. Ele usa os protocolos de comunicação SATA e NVMe. Essas unidades são conectadas diretamente a uma porta específica localizada na placa-mãe. Dessa maneira, evitamos ocupar slots PCI-E e teremos portas específicas. Esse padrão não possui a velocidade do PCI-E, mas é muito maior que o SATA e já existem unidades de todos os fabricantes a preços moderados.

Aspectos a considerar de um SSD

Ao comprar um SSD, precisamos conhecer suas vantagens e desvantagens e se nosso sistema é apropriado.

Sistemas de arquivos

Como vimos, o gerenciamento de uma unidade SSD é bem diferente do que vimos nos discos rígidos normais. É por isso que os sistemas de arquivos tradicionais tiveram a necessidade de atualizar sua estrutura operacional interna para atender às necessidades dessas unidades. Caso contrário, causaria uma rápida degradação das unidades, reduzindo drasticamente sua vida útil.

NTFS

Um exemplo claro é o sistema de arquivos do Windows. Uma das primeiras otimizações implementadas, desde que o Windows Vista foi o alinhamento correto da partição ao sistema. Isso permitiu a realização de operações extras de leitura e gravação, porque a organização dos setores é diferente em unidades mecânicas e SSD.

Nas versões posteriores do Windows 7, os sistemas implementam melhorias nos SSDs, como a desativação do desfragmentador de arquivos, o serviço Superfetch, ReadyBoost e a introdução do comando TRIM para prolongar a vida útil do SSD.

Vantagens de um SSD sobre um disco mecânico

  • Leitura / Gravação: Aumento significativo nas operações básicas, eliminando os componentes mecânicos. Sua característica mais apreciável e significativa. Abertura de aplicativos e arquivos: diretamente do acima exposto, os aplicativos e arquivos abrem muito mais rapidamente e o tempo de inicialização do computador diminui drasticamente. Falhas e segurança: o tempo entre falhas aumenta consideravelmente e a segurança das transações aumenta, melhorando a limpeza de dados e não há variação no desempenho quando a unidade está cheia ou vazia. A exclusão de arquivos também é mais segura, pois uma vez excluídos fisicamente, os arquivos ficam completamente irrecuperáveis. Energia: exigirá menos consumo de energia e produção de calor. Ruído: como não existem elementos mecânicos, a produção de ruído será zero. Peso e resistência: ao reduzir os componentes mecânicos e o tamanho, o peso deles é menor e a resistência a choques é muito melhor.

Desvantagens de um SSD

  • Vida útil: essas unidades geralmente têm menos vida útil do que os discos tradicionais. Isso é relativo à intensidade de uso que é dada a eles e à tecnologia de fabricação. Preço: o custo por GB é consideravelmente mais alto que os discos tradicionais. Portanto, encontramos discos com capacidade muito menor a preços mais altos. Capacidade de armazenamento: os discos rígidos ainda existem no mercado com menos capacidade de armazenamento do que os discos mecânicos. Não devido a limitações de hardware (desde há algum tempo, foi publicado que a Nimbus Data planejava construir um SSD de 100 TB), mas por causa do custo delas. Recuperação de dados: Conforme discutido nas vantagens, os SSDs excluem arquivos permanentemente, e isso também é uma desvantagem se o que queremos é recuperar arquivos excluídos. Apesar disso, a tecnologia TRIM nos oferece uma oportunidade a esse respeito. Falhas catastróficas: enquanto os discos mecânicos estão gradualmente se degradando e podemos notar, os SSDs falham sem aviso e esse erro é total e final. Portanto, perderemos os arquivos quase completamente com segurança. Tarefas de manutenção: nesse caso, essas tarefas são muito prejudiciais para o disco rígido. Desfragmentar um SSD não faz sentido, mas não é recomendável configurar parte do espaço na memória virtual. Esse processo faz com que ele se desgaste ainda mais.

Se você quiser conhecer todos os detalhes sobre discos rígidos mecânicos, recomendamos nosso artigo:

Com isso, concluímos nossa explicação sobre o que é um SSD e como ele funciona. Isso foi útil para você? Você tem alguma pergunta? ?

Tutoriais

Escolha dos editores

Back to top button